Understanding FM 200 Cylinder Hydrostatic Testing
FM 200 cylinders are critical components in fire suppression systems. Hydrostatic testing involves subjecting these cylinders to high levels of pressure to detect any leaks or weaknesses in their structure. This testing is not only crucial for compliance with safety standards but also for the protection of personnel and property.
Why Hydrostatic Testing is Necessary
- Safety Compliance: Many regulatory bodies require hydrostatic testing as part of safety compliance protocols.
- Preventative Maintenance: Regular testing helps identify potential issues before they become critical failures.
- Prolonging Lifespan: By ensuring the integrity of the cylinder, hydrostatic testing can extend its usable life.
Frequency of Hydrostatic Testing
Hydrostatic testing of FM 200 cylinders should be conducted at regular intervals. The following guidelines can help:
- Every 5 years: This is a general standard for hydrostatic testing in many jurisdictions.
- Post-accident or damage: Any FM 200 cylinder that has been involved in an incident should be tested immediately.
- After modifications or repairs: If a cylinder has undergone repairs or alterations, it should be tested to ensure safety.

The Testing Process
Understanding the hydrostatic testing process can alleviate common confusions:
- Preparation of Equipment: Ensure all necessary tools and equipment are in working condition.
- Filling the Cylinder: The cylinder is filled with water or another incompressible fluid to test for leaks.
- Applying Pressure: The cylinder is pressurized to a specified level while monitoring for leaks.
- Assessment: After the test, the cylinder is assessed for any signs of failure.
